Quick Info: Kids Folkstyle State Qualifiers and Championships
The top three wrestlers in each age group and division at the Kids Folkstyle State Qualifiers (March 22nd) qualify to compete at the WWF Kids Folkstyle State Championships at the Alliant Energy Center March 28-30th. Kids can wrestle at any of the eight qualifier locations. All qualifiers will use the new USA Bracketing system; Kids state will use Trackwrestling.

Coaching Credentials: Need-To-Know Guide
Planning to coach matside at the 2025 WWF State Series? Make sure you've got the right credentials! Click here to view the guide we made for this season. Quick hitters:

  • Kids Folkstyle State Qualifiers: A current USA Wrestling Leaders membership is required to be matside at the WWF Kids State Qualifiers on March 22nd— this includes parents, club coaches, etc. Please allow 7-10 business days for the background check process, as USA Wrestling Leaders Memberships will not be available on-site.
  • Kids Folkstyle State: A current USA Wrestling Leaders membership and a Copper Coaches Certification or higher is required to be matside at the Kids State Championships— this includes parents, club coaches, etc. Please allow 7-10 business days for the background check process, as USA Wrestling Leaders Memberships will not be available on-site.
  • NOW AVAILABLE: Coaches passes (required) for state are available for purchase (click here) in the USAW Membership System now through March 25th for $20. Coaches must have a profile photo uploaded and approved by USA Wrestling to their USAW profile for the printed pass. If a coach misses the Tuesday deadline, they may continue to purchase a coaches pass until Thursday midnight for $50. If purchasing onsite, coaches may be delayed getting matside until the pass has been processed and approved by USA Wrestling. Passes are good for all sessions.
